首页 话题 小组 问答 好文 用户 我的社区 域名交易 唠叨

[教程]揭秘火柴人:C语言编程入门实战攻略

发布于 2025-07-13 01:00:33
0
1371

引言火柴人,作为经典的编程练习素材,因其简单形象、易于理解而受到许多编程爱好者的喜爱。本文将带领读者通过C语言编程,从零基础开始,一步步实践制作一个火柴人动画,帮助读者深入了解C语言编程的基础知识。1...

引言

火柴人,作为经典的编程练习素材,因其简单形象、易于理解而受到许多编程爱好者的喜爱。本文将带领读者通过C语言编程,从零基础开始,一步步实践制作一个火柴人动画,帮助读者深入了解C语言编程的基础知识。

1. 火柴人动画简介

火柴人动画,顾名思义,是由简单的火柴图形构成的动画。它通过改变火柴人的位置和动作,模拟出各种有趣的效果。火柴人动画在C语言编程中,可以帮助初学者更好地理解变量、循环、条件语句等编程概念。

2. 火柴人动画制作步骤

2.1 环境搭建

首先,我们需要安装C语言编译器。Windows用户可以选择Dev-C++,Linux用户可以选择GCC。

2.2 编写代码

以下是一个简单的火柴人动画示例代码:

#include 
#include 
#include 
int main() { int i; for (i = 0; i < 5; i++) { printf(" * *\n"); printf(" * *\n"); printf(" * *\n"); printf(" * *\n"); printf("*********\n"); usleep(100000); // 延迟0.1秒 system("clear"); // 清屏 } return 0;
}

2.3 运行程序

编译并运行上述代码,你将看到一个简单的火柴人动画。

3. 火柴人动画进阶

3.1 动画效果优化

通过调整代码,可以改变火柴人的动作和效果。例如,可以让火柴人跳跃、行走等。

3.2 多火柴人动画

通过引入数组,可以同时控制多个火柴人进行动画。

3.3 火柴人互动

可以尝试加入用户交互,让火柴人根据用户的输入进行不同的动作。

4. 总结

通过制作火柴人动画,我们可以更好地理解C语言编程的基础知识。在实践过程中,不断尝试和改进,将有助于提高编程能力。希望本文能对C语言编程入门者有所帮助。

评论
一个月内的热帖推荐
csdn大佬
Lv.1普通用户

452398

帖子

22

小组

841

积分

赞助商广告
站长交流